Best Sports Workouts for Cardio and Endurance
To maximize both cardio and endurance, your workouts should combine aerobic exercises with strength-building routines. Here are the top sports workouts designed to enhance your heart health, lung capacity, and muscular endurance.
1. Running and Sprint Intervals
Running is one of the simplest yet most effective ways to boost cardiovascular fitness. Incorporating sprint intervals into your running routine adds intensity, helping to improve both speed and endurance. Sprint intervals involve alternating between high-speed bursts and slower recovery periods.
Why it works:
-
Boosts heart and lung efficiency
-
Improves fast-twitch muscle response
-
Burns more calories in less time
Practical Note: Start with a 1:2 ratio of sprint to rest (e.g., 30 seconds sprint, 60 seconds walk) and gradually increase intensity over time.
2. Cycling Workouts
Cycling, whether outdoors or on a stationary bike, is a low-impact cardiovascular exercise that strengthens leg muscles and increases stamina. Endurance cycling sessions help build aerobic capacity, while hill sprints or resistance intervals enhance strength and power.
Why it works:
-
Reduces joint stress compared to running
-
Strengthens quads, hamstrings, and glutes
-
Improves overall endurance and cardiovascular health
Practical Note: Include one long-distance ride per week and 2-3 shorter high-intensity sessions to balance endurance and cardio.
3. Swimming
Swimming is a full-body workout that engages multiple muscle groups while enhancing cardiovascular capacity. The resistance of water increases the effort required, which naturally builds endurance.
Why it works:
-
Provides a low-impact workout for joints
-
Improves lung capacity and oxygen intake
-
Enhances overall body strength
Practical Note: Alternate strokes—freestyle for speed, breaststroke for endurance—to target different muscle groups.
4. High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T)
HIIT combines short bursts of intense activity with brief rest periods. This type of training pushes your cardiovascular system and muscular endurance simultaneously. Sports like boxing, circuit training, or plyometrics benefit from HIIT.
Why it works:
-
Improves VO2 max, a key measure of cardiovascular fitness
-
Increases metabolism and calorie burn
-
Enhances both aerobic and anaerobic endurance
Practical Note: Limit HIIT to 2-3 times per week to prevent overtraining and ensure adequate recovery.
5. Rowing
Rowing engages both upper and lower body muscles while providing an excellent cardio workout. It’s ideal for building endurance and core strength simultaneously.
Why it works:
-
Works nearly every muscle group
-
Boosts stamina and lung efficiency
-
Low-impact on joints, reducing injury risk
Practical Note: Use a rowing machine for structured workouts, alternating between steady-state rows and sprint intervals.
6. Jump Rope
Jumping rope is a simple yet highly effective cardio exercise that improves coordination and endurance. It also enhances agility and timing, making it valuable for athletes in sports like basketball, boxing, and soccer.
Why it works:
-
Rapidly increases heart rate
-
Improves footwork and coordination
-
Strengthens calves and core
Practical Note: Begin with 5-minute sessions and gradually increase duration as endurance improves.
Practical Tips to Maximize Cardio and Endurance Workouts
1. Focus on Consistency
Endurance and cardiovascular improvements don’t happen overnight. A consistent routine, even with moderate intensity, produces better long-term results than sporadic high-intensity efforts.
2. Mix Cardio Types
Avoid plateauing by incorporating a mix of running, swimming, cycling, and HIIT workouts. This variation challenges different muscle groups and keeps your training engaging.
3. Prioritize Recovery
Muscles need time to repair and adapt. Include rest days or active recovery sessions to prevent burnout, reduce injury risk, and improve performance in the long run.
Integrating Workouts with Lifestyle
Endurance and cardio workouts are most effective when combined with proper nutrition, hydration, and sleep. Consuming a balanced diet rich in protein and complex carbs provides the energy necessary for sustained performance. Staying hydrated ensures cardiovascular efficiency, while sufficient sleep supports muscle recovery and stamina.
For athletes or fitness enthusiasts aiming to enhance overall endurance, tracking progress can be motivating. Keep a journal of distances, times, or repetitions, and adjust your routine based on performance improvements. Incorporating wearable technology like heart rate monitors or smartwatches can help monitor intensity and recovery trends.
